How they compare
Tokelau currently reports 87.5 % against 86.83 % in Botswana, a difference of 0.67 %.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Botswana ahead.
Botswana ranks 39th and Tokelau ranks 36th of 209 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Botswana averaged higher in 2 and Tokelau in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Botswana | Tokelau |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 94.67 % | 75 % | 19.67 % | Botswana |
| 2000s | 91.77 % | 90 % | 1.77 % | Botswana |
| 2010s | 78.26 % | 86.33 % | 8.07 % | Tokelau |
| 2020s | 85.63 % | 88.75 % | 3.12 % | Tokelau |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ions indicators disseminates indicators on sectoral shares of total national gre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ions as well as three indicators of emissions intensity: per capita emissions; emissions per value of agricultural production; and emissions per area of agricultural land.
